    Which electric razor do you use?

    Well, the old Norelco slipped from my hand and clipped the edge of the commode - and shattered the retaining ring around the triple head. I super-glued it together but it's already getting loose after 2 weeks. I'm going to have to loosen the purse strings and spring for another so I'm asking around for experiences with other brands. I'd go back to a safety razor and creame, which I do on the wekends, but I get in a hurry in the mornings and look like a turkey who barely escaped the axe - less hurried on the weekends. So, what's the consensus - Norelco, Braun, etc, etc

    I used to like Braun for YEARS until the battery finally wouldn't hold a charge. I went to Best Buy and they happened to be blowing out some Remingtons for like $10, so I've been using that ever since. Gets the job done. Only problem so far is that you can't plug it in and use it. So when the batteries run dry, you need wait for it to charge up again! (Discovered this after shaving half my face before heading off to work. )

      I'm a Norelco fan. Like the ability to run from the wall if the battery's down, the popup clipper, battery indicator. Have a cheap little Braun for use when traveling.

        Norelco

        I have been using a Norelco razor since 1968, except for about 6 months when I used a Remington. I never thought that the Remington did as good a job on me as the Norelco, and it failed early. I don't think I have had over 5 or 6 different Norelco's in that time span.
